Steel Exports Report: Taiwan
Background
Taiwan, as of 2017, is the world’s thirteenth-largest steel exporter. In 2018, Taiwan exported 12.2 million metric tons of steel, a one percent increase from 12.0 million metric tons in 2017. Taiwan’s exports represented about 3 percent of all steel exported globally in 2017, based on available data. The volume of Taiwan’s 2018 steel exports was one-sixth that of the world’s largest exporter, China, and nearly one-third that of the second-largest exporter, Japan. In value terms, steel represented just 3.6 percent of the total amount of goods Taiwan exported in 2018.
Taiwan exports steel to more than 130 countries and territories. The ten countries highlighted in the map below represent the top markets for Taiwan’s exports of steel, receiving more than 450 thousand metric tons each and accounting for 67 percent of Taiwan’s steel exports in 2018.
Rising exports and falling imports caused Taiwan’s steel trade deficit to become a steel trade surplus between 2006 and 2007. Imports continued to fall in the wake of the global recession, hitting a low point in 2009. From 2009 to 2018, imports have increased 17 percent but were still down 31 percent from 2005 levels. Exports increased 24 percent between 2009 and 2018. In 2018, Taiwan’s steel trade surplus amounted to 4.55 million metric tons, down 2 percent from 4.63 million metric tons in 2017.
